WebAbstract: Constant duty cycle controlled discontinuous conduction mode (DCM) flyback power factor correction (PFC) converter has the advantage of high power factor (PF) and the disadvantage of low efficiency. While, constant on-time (COT) controlled critical conduction mode (CRM) flyback PFC converter has the exact opposite features, besides its …

WebMar 12, 2014 · The operation principles of the traditional constant on-time (COT)-controlled CRM flyback PFC converter and VOT-controlled CRM flyback PFC converter are analyzed. The experimental results show that the PF and THD of the VOT-controlled CRM flyback PFC converter are better than those of the COT-controlled CRM flyback PFC converter.
